Ingredients For thanks for the memories, mom & gram! - jammie cookies
-
2 pkgactive dry yeast
-
1/4 cwarm water
-
7 call-purpose flour
-
1 tspsalt
-
2 cbutter, softened
-
4eggs, slightly beaten
-
2 cwhipping cream
-
fruit preserves, your choice
How To Make thanks for the memories, mom & gram! - jammie cookies
-
1In a small bowl, dissolve the yeast in warm water.
-
2In a large bowl, combine flour and salt, cut in the butter until crumbly.
-
3Stir in the yeast, eggs and whipping cream.
-
4Turn the dough onto a lightly floured surface, knead until smooth, 2 to 3 minutes.
-
5Place in a greased bowl, turn greased side up. Cover, refrigerate until firm, about 6 hours or overnight.
-
6Heat oven to 375 degrees.
-
7Roll out dough, 1/2 at a time, on sugared surface to 1/8 of an inch thickness.
-
8Cut into 3-inch squares and put a teaspoon of preserves in the center of each square.
-
9Bring up two opposite corners to the center and pinch together tightly to seal then fold to one side and pinch again to seal.
-
10Place then an inch apart on an ungreased cookie sheet.
-
11Bake for 10 to 15 minutes or until lightly browned.
-
12Makes about 5 dozen.
